Biography

In the 1880 census Oliver (age 3 months) was the son of Jessee H. Gains in Mishawaka, St Joseph, Indiana, United States.[1]

William died in 1951 and was buried in Rosehill Cemetery and Mausoleum, Chicago, Cook County, Illinois, United States.[2]
